For over 50 years, the Critical Care business within Edwards Lifesciences (NYSE: EW) has operated at the intersection of groundbreaking medical innovation and improved patient care. Put simply, we exist because we're committed to creating a world where every patient who should be monitored will be monitored with smart technology.

With this impactful vision in mind, we are now embarking on becoming an independent business from Edwards, a process that we currently expect to be completed by January 2025.

As Critical Care transitions to an independent company, we will continue to benefit from the expertise and experience of 4,000+ dedicated global employees, a vibrant innovation engine with strong investment in our future pipeline, and strong sales growth and profitability. We are well-positioned to build upon our category leadership as we continue to launch new solutions powered by A.I. to clinicians, and expand into new care settings.

The Territory Manager manages the relationship with a defined list of large Edwards customers, looking to grow Edwards' share of wallet. Identifies, develops and closes new sales opportunities within portfolio of own business unit.

Key Responsibilities:

• Serves as main point of contact within own business unit for assigned customer base utilizing full understanding of hemodynamic monitoring and/or cardiovascular anatomy, pathology and physiology relevant to EW medical products as it relates to the business
• Builds and manages strong, long-lasting relationships with customers, referrers, surgeons and other influencers in assigned region to push Edwards positioning in the market utilizing creativity and influencing skills with new or existing customers on buying decisions using tact and diplomacy
• Develops and closes new business opportunities with existing customers and identifies areas of improvement to meet sales targets while developing and executing annual plan to achieve region objectives
